Justin Osborne is the lead singer, songwriter, and guitarist for the band SUSTO, who hail from Charleston, South Carolina. They’ve been around for over a decade, toured all over the world, and released five studio albums and two live albums. They’re currently on New West Records and Justin has a new album titled “Susto Stringband: Volume 1” coming out on March 28th that is a collaboration with Holler Choir Music and together they’ve reimagined and reinvented songs from across the SUSTO catalog (plus given us two new tracks!) with a more bluegrass, folk, string-centric spin.
